Functionalized low molecular weight sterically encumbered oligomers

1. A composition of matter comprising a functionalized oligomer obtained by ring opening metathesis polymerization (ROMP) of tetracyclododecene monomer and a sterically encumbered cyclic monomer with an olefinic chain transfer agent at a molar ratio of the tetracyclododecene monomer and the sterically encumbered cyclic monomer to olefinic chain transfer agent from 3:1 to about 40:1, wherein the olefinic chain transfer agent comprises allyl glycidyl ether, allyl Si(OEt)3, allyl-CH2—CH(O)CH2, allyl-CH2—N—(SiMe3)2, or a combination thereof, and wherein the sterically encumbered cyclic monomer comprises 5-trifluoromethyl-5,6,6-trifluoro-2-norbornene.
